The Allure of Dubai Chocolate

What makes Dubai chocolate in Australia stand out is its signature blend of tradition and innovation. Dubai’s chocolatiers often use high-quality cocoa sourced from Africa and South America, but it’s their unique Middle Eastern twist — with flavors like saffron, dates, pistachio, and rose — that captures the imagination of Australian consumers. Each piece reflects the city’s opulence and cosmopolitan flair, turning simple chocolate into an art form. Australians, known for their appreciation of gourmet experiences, are embracing this luxury taste with open arms.

3. Middle Eastern Grocery Stores and Gift Shops

Another hidden gem for finding Dubai chocolate in Australia is local Middle Eastern grocery stores and cultural gift shops. Cities with vibrant multicultural communities — like Sydney’s Auburn, Melbourne’s Coburg, and Perth’s Mirrabooka — have shops that import sweets and delicacies directly from Dubai.

These stores not only stock chocolates but also other Middle Eastern favorites like dates, baklava, and nuts — creating an authentic shopping experience. The best part? The prices are often more affordable than luxury boutiques, making it a great option for both personal indulgence and gifting.
